The volume of water in 1 square inch depends on the depth of the water. For example, if you have 1 square inch of water that is 1 inch deep, it would contain approximately 1 cubic inch of water, which is about 0.0164 liters or 0.0043 gallons. Without a specified depth, it's impossible to determine the exact amount of water.
The amount of water a hosepipe uses depends on its flow rate, which is measured in liters per minute or hour. To calculate the total amount of water used, you would need to know the flow rate and the duration the hosepipe is run.
